The General Secretariat of the Council would like to inform you that
provisional agendas of the Council, COREPER and other preparatory bodies
of the Council are public documents and available for consultation and/or
downloading on the Council's website under "[1]Transparency and access to
documents" or under "[2]Meetings".
 
Council and COREPER minutes are also available through the same links.
 
Alternatively, you can also search for these documents in the public
register of Council documents. You can consult the register at
[3]http://register.consilium.europa.eu/.
 
The most recent list of Council preparatory bodies can be found in
document [4]5183/16. Each preparatory body of the Council has its own
working methods. Not all of these bodies systematically prepare minutes of
its meetings. If you are interested in following the activity of a
preparatory body, you can consult the documents mentioned in the
provisional agendas of that body or search the register for existing
outcome of proceedings of Council working parties.
 
The text boxes below provide useful information about how to search the
register for these documents.

How to search the register for provisional agendas of Council / Coreper?
 
Go to [5]Home - Consilium (the home page of the Council's website).
 
From the top horizontal menu choose "[6]Documents and publications".
 
Click on "search in the register" and introduce in the field "Subject
Matter" the code OJ CONS / OJ CRP1 / OJ CRP2. As a result you will get a
list of the agendas of the Council / the agendas of Coreper 1 / the
agendas of Coreper 2.
 
The lists of items ready for adoption by the Council (no discussion is
foreseen) is called list of "A" items) and can be found with the subject
matter PTS A. If you wish to search for the agendas or "A" items lists of
specific Council configurations, you can add the name (eg. General
Affairs) in the field "Words in subject".
 
All these documents are public and can be directly downloaded.

 

How to search the register for provisional agenda of working parties?
 
Go to [7]Home - Consilium (the home page of the Council's website).
 
From the top horizontal menu choose "[8]Documents and publications".
 
Click on "search in the register" and introduce in the field "words in
title" the official designation of the working party (e.g. Asylum Working
Party) then from the drop down list of the field "document type" choose
"PROVISIONAL AGENDA".
 
As a result you will get a list of the agendas of the identified working
party. If you wish to narrow down your results, you can add a time period
with the field "date of meeting".
 
All these documents are public and can be directly downloaded.

 
 

How to search the register for minutes of the Council?
 
Go to [9]Home - Consilium (the home page of the Council's website).
 
From the top horizontal menu choose "[10]Documents and publications".
 
Click on "search in the register" and introduce in the field "Subject
Matter" the code PV CONS. As a result, you will get a list of Council
minutes. If you wish to search for the minutes of specific Council
configurations, you can add the name (eg. General Affairs) in the field
"Words in subject".
 
The addenda to Council minutes related to the legislative deliberations
part of the agenda and to any other item discussed in open session are
public and can be directly downloaded.
 
Some Council minutes have already been made public as well, however, if
you find a document that cannot be directly downloaded (marked by a "grey"
pdf icon), you may introduce a request for access by using the available
electronic form

 
 

How to search the register for minutes of Coreper?
 
Go to [11]Home - Consilium (the home page of the Council's website).
 
From the top horizontal menu choose "[12]Documents and publications".
 
Click on "search in the register" and introduce in the field "Subject
Matter" the code CRS/CRP. As a result, you will get a list of Coreper
minutes.
 
All these documents are public and can be directly downloaded.

 

How to search the register for outcome of proceedings of working parties?
 
Go to [13]Home - Consilium (the home page of the Council's website).
 
From the top horizontal menu choose "[14]Documents and publications".
 
Click on "search in the register" and choose from the drop down menu of
the field "Document type" the option "Outcome of proceedings". As a
result, you will get a list of outcome of proceedings of working parties.
 
Some of these outcome of proceedings have already been made public,
however, if you find a document that cannot be directly downloaded (marked
by a "grey" pdf icon), you may introduce a request for access by using the
available electronic form.
